Metang (Japanese:メタングMetang) is a dual-typeSteel/PsychicPokémon introduced inGeneration III.

Itevolves fromBeldum starting atlevel 20 and evolves intoMetagross starting at level 45.

Biology

Concept art of Metang forPokémon the Series: Ruby and Sapphire

Metang is a roboticPokémon with teal, metallic skin. It has a disc-shaped body with a pair of flat, gray spikes on either side toward the rear. A jet cannot scratch Metang due to its strong body. There is a gray spike in the middle of its face, similar to a nose. A pair of red eyes reside in two holes in its metallic skin. While it appears to lack legs, it has a pair of thick arms with three claws on the ends. The arms are considerably thicker below the elbow and have a flat, blunt protrusion extending over the joint.

Metang is formed when twoBeldum fuse together. A magnetic nervous system joins the brains of these two Pokémon. This linkage allows Metang to generate a strong, psychokinetic power that is doubled. However, this does not increase its intellect. This Pokémon's high intelligence and strong magnetic field are other sources of powerful psychic energy. In addition to generating psychic power, its magnetism allows Metang to hover in midair. It is able to rotate its arms backwards in order to travel at speeds over 60 mph (100 km/h) in search of prey. When Metang finds its prey, it uses its psychic power to stop it from escaping. Then it firmly grabs onto the prey with its claws, never letting go. Metang's claws are able to rip through steel. This Pokémon lives onrough terrains and harsh mountains. It pursuesNosepass, loving its magnetic minerals.

In animation

Metang inPokémon the Series: Sun & Moon

Major appearances

Morrison's Metang

Metang debuted inSaved by the Beldum, afterMorrison's Beldum evolved whilst battlingJump'sElectabuzz in theEver Grande Conference. It was mostly seenoutside its Poké Ball.

Other

InBibarel Gnaws Best!, thehead engineer used a Metang with anAggron andMagmar to attack aBibarel, but Bibarel dodged its attack. It was eventually defeated by a combination ofAsh's Chimchar'sFlamethrower, andAsh's Turtwig's andBrock's Sudowoodo'sRazor Leaf attacks.

InSteeling Peace of Mind!, a Metang was affected byTeam Galactic's meddling onIron Island.

InThe Synchronicity Test!,Alain used a Metang in a battle againstAsh's Noivern and was able to defeat it in a close match. InAnalysis Versus Passion!, it was revealed that Metang had evolved into a Metagross.

Starting inA Mission of Ultra Urgency!,Sophocles used aRide Metang forUltra Guardians missions. InSparking Confusion!, it battled awildAlolanGolem.

InFlying Pikachu, Rising Higher and Higher!,Orla's Metagross appeared as a Metang during a flashback.

Minor appearances

InPillars of Friendship!,J's henchmen used multiple Metang to attack theBattle Pyramid. They were eventually defeated byPiplup'sBubble Beam.

InZoroark: Master of Illusions, a Metang was on the Cianwood Greens Pokémon Baccer team with aBeldum andMetagross, which competed in thePokémon Baccer World Cup. It reappeared inGenesect and the Legend Awakened.

Trivia

Origin

Metang is made of two Beldum merged. Aside from that, it may be based onflying saucers andcrabs.

Name origin

Metang may be a combination ofmetal andtang (onomatopoeic sound of metal being struck) orétang (French for the colorpond blue). Metang is also an anagram ofmagnet.
